Understanding Jackpot Mechanics: Progressive vs. Fixed

The “jackpot” aspect of these games is a crucial component of their appeal. However, it’s important to understand the different types of jackpots available. The two primary categories are progressive jackpots and fixed jackpots. A fixed jackpot remains constant, meaning the payout amount is predetermined and does not change based on player activity. While still substantial, fixed jackpots are generally smaller than progressive jackpots. This is a more predictable system, offering a guaranteed prize for hitting the winning combination. These are often tied to specific symbol combinations or bonus round triggers, providing a clear path to potential winnings.

Progressive jackpots, on the other hand, are funded by a small portion of each wager placed on the game. This creates a continuously growing prize pool that can reach enormous sums, often into the millions. Because the jackpot grows with every play, the potential payout is significantly higher than with a fixed jackpot. However, the odds of winning a progressive jackpot are typically lower, reflecting the increased reward. These jackpots are often linked across multiple casinos, further accelerating their growth and attracting a wider player base. A significant element is the "seed" amount, which is the minimum guaranteed payout for a progressive jackpot if it hasn't been won for a long time. This ensures players always have a considerable potential reward.

Random Number Generators and Fair Play

Regardless of the jackpot type, it is paramount to understand the role of Random Number Generators (RNGs) in ensuring fair play. RNGs are sophisticated algorithms that generate completely random outcomes for each spin. This randomness is independently audited by third-party organizations to verify that the games are unbiased and that the advertised payout percentages are accurate. Without RNGs and regular audits, the integrity of the games would be compromised. These audits ensure that all players have an equal chance of winning, regardless of their betting strategy or playing history.

Reputable online casinos and game developers openly display their RNG certification information, providing transparency and building trust with players. Players should always look for this information before playing any online casino game. Understanding how RNGs work, and the importance of independent auditing, can greatly enhance a player’s confidence in the fairness and reliability of the games.

Strategies for Maximizing Your Jackpot Raider Experience

While casino games ultimately rely on chance, there are strategies players can employ to maximize their enjoyment and potentially increase their odds of winning. One key strategy is understanding the game’s paytable. The paytable outlines the winning combinations, the value of each symbol, and the requirements for triggering bonus features. Familiarizing yourself with the paytable allows you to make informed betting decisions and to understand the potential payouts of different combinations. It's also useful to understand the volatility of the game; higher volatility games offer larger, but less frequent wins, while lower volatility games provide more frequent, but smaller payouts.

Another important strategy is managing your bankroll. Setting a budget before you start playing and sticking to it is crucial for responsible gambling. Avoid chasing losses, and be prepared to walk away when you’ve reached your limit. It can also be beneficial to take advantage of casino bonuses and promotions, which can provide extra funds to play with. However, always read the terms and conditions of these bonuses carefully, as they often come with wagering requirements.

Bankroll Management and Responsible Gambling

Effective bankroll management is perhaps the most critical skill for any casino player. Determine a specific amount you are willing to spend and treat it as entertainment expenses. Avoid the temptation to deposit more money than you can afford to lose. Divide your bankroll into smaller betting units and adjust your bet size based on your risk tolerance. Players seeking longer playing sessions may prefer smaller bets, while those aiming for larger payouts might opt for higher stakes, understanding the increased risk involved.

Responsible gambling is equally important. Recognize the signs of problem gambling, such as chasing losses, gambling with money you need for essentials, or experiencing negative emotions related to gambling. If you suspect you or someone you know may have a gambling problem, seek help from a reputable organization specializing in gambling addiction.
